Exclusive: THE PREDATOR Gets Vinyl Release and This is What it Looks Like

Prepare for the ultimate hunt as Lakeshore Records is going to be releasing composer Henry Jackman’s (Kong: Skull Island) original score for last year’s The Predator on February 22. Jackman’s music pays homage to Alan Silvestri’s score from the 1987 original and utilized a 180-piece orchestra!

The double gatefold 2xLP will be released in “Transparent Hunter Green w/ Black Smoke” and we know that reading that doesn’t help as much as an image, so head on down below to see the packaging in all its glory!
